A standard document providing a model residential assured periodic tenancy agreement (APT) for property located in England. This standard document establishes the core legal rights and obligations between a landlord and tenant. It details fundamental provisions such as the payment of rent and the tenant's responsibilities regarding property use and care of the contents. The agreement also sets out the landlord's key covenants, including repairing obligations under the Landlord and Tenant Act 1985 (LTA 1985) and ensuring the tenant's quiet enjoyment. This standard document addresses procedures for tenant default and the landlord's right of re-entry, considering the requirements of the Housing Act 1988 (HA 1988). It includes an optional guarantee and indemnity clause to secure the tenant's performance. This agreement contains the required provisions for APTs after 1 May 2026, when the changes made by the Renters' Rights Act 2025 (RRA 2025) come into force.
